Embark on an exhilarating whitewater rafting adventure down the Green River near Whistler. Perfect for thrill-seekers and nature lovers alike, this guided tour combines excitement, scenic beauty, and outdoor fun. Keep reading to find out more about this unforgettable experience!
Experience the thrill of whitewater paddling on the Green River with The Adventure Group Whistler. This guided rafting tour offers an exhilarating adventure through Canada's stunning wilderness, suitable for both newcomers and seasoned thrill-seekers. As you navigate the lively rapids, you'll enjoy breathtaking views of the surrounding mountains and lush forests, making it a perfect escape into nature. The trip combines adrenaline-pumping action with opportunities to observe local wildlife and learn about the area's natural history from expert guides. Safety is a top priority, and all participants are equipped with state-of-the-art gear and briefed thoroughly before hitting the water. Whether you're seeking a fun family outing or an adrenaline-filled day with friends, this tour delivers unforgettable memories and a true connection to wilderness adventure.
